### Key Ceremony Checklist — Item 4 (Linkways Router)

Before we sign the deep-link routing manifest for Pocketpath, double-check that every universal-link pattern in the Brindle config resolves to exactly one screen. No wildcards, no duplicates. Once you've eyeballed it and the second reviewer nods, unlock the signing enclave with the passphrase that follows.

strongbox words: prawyn-fenmir

[ ] Confirm order-cutoff rule active before deploy. Crumbline bakery orders placed after 14:00 local must roll to next-day fulfillment. Verify the cutoff clock uses store timezone, not server time — this broke twice last quarter. Test one order at 13:59 and one at 14:01 in staging. If both route correctly, check this item and record the build token printed below.

pipeline stamp: htk9_ce63042d9

## Service Accounts — StormFan Alert Fan-Out

The fan-out worker authenticates to the internal dispatch tier using the svc-stormfan account. Rotate quarterly; scopes are limited to publish-only on alert topics. If deliveries stall during your shift, verify the worker is using the current credential, reproduced below for reference.

API key for kaweg-hahif: kto4_rAjZ

Runbook 7.1 — Master Key Set Transfer. Dispatch desk: the master key set for the Stonewick Annexe moves by courier only, never pool vehicles. Keys travel in the tamper-evident pouch, logged out by facilities before departure. One run, no combined loads, no overnight holds. Receiving facilities officer must be present; no desk drops, no reception hand-offs. Record seal number at both ends. Any discrepancy: halt and escalate immediately. Hand-over instruction for the courier follows.

dispatch memo: the eliath belael courier leaves the praox ledger at gate 8841 under passcode 017589

TICKET-2291: LockerLoop laundry-locker access flow — DB connection failures

Flagging for the release freeze: the locker-unlock flow on Clothespin Junction kiosks is timing out roughly 1 in 20 attempts. The access service exhausts its connection pool under peak evening load, and users end up staring at a spinning padlock. Pool size bump is in branch hotfix/locker-pool; needs your sign-off before Thursday's cut. To reproduce, run the access service locally against staging. The staging database connection string follows.

replica DSN, kajep-yahag: mssql://praok_svc:iF@db-8d68.plorvaio.local:5432/eliion